James King offers integrative counselling, primarily person-centred, incorporating CBT and psychodynamic approaches. He works with clients to explore issues at their own pace, providing telephone, online, and face-to-face sessions.

Victoria Ashadu is a qualified Art Psychotherapist based in Manchester, England, offering services through Muawé Healing Arts. Her practice is rooted in the belief that art provides a non-confrontational and non-judgmental avenue for expression and emotional management. Victoria is registered with the Health and Care Professions Council (HCPC) and is a member of the British Association of Art Therapists (BAAT). She specialises in Adverse Childhood Experiences (ACEs) trauma for both young people and adults, and also practices Attachment-Based Therapy. Victoria works with young people, men, and women, providing a safe and nurturing environment for individuals to explore their inner worlds. Her approach incorporates assessment, formulation, and psychological interventions, including parent work, group therapy, and individual treatments, with a holistic, collaborative focus on client well-being.
